Jhonatan Narvaez won the 195-kilometer 11th stage of the Giro d'Italia from Porcari to Chiavari on May 15, 2026, while Afonso Eulalio defended the Maglia Rosa as overall leader.
Ecuadorian cyclist Jhonatan Narvaez secured his third stage win of the year, beating Spain's Enric Mas in a tight sprint finish after 195 kilometers of racing. The peloton took a relatively relaxed approach to the stage, which featured no major climbs.
Portugal's Afonso Eulalio, the surprise leader of this year's Giro, successfully defended the Maglia Rosa (pink jersey) as overall race leader. He maintained his advantage against top favorite Jonas Vingegaard of Denmark, who now sits 27 seconds behind in the general classification.
